Output 64c2bf89a486fd0ffb946213dfb8bbacb629df2f0d314fe1ccd9f862dba2dec6:0

value
2106452
script pubkey
OP_0 OP_PUSHBYTES_20 c3964d1eeb535aee9c3158b832f0fe12d59f152d
address
bc1qcwty68ht2ddwa8p3tzur9u87zt2e79fd22f3hg
transaction
64c2bf89a486fd0ffb946213dfb8bbacb629df2f0d314fe1ccd9f862dba2dec6
spent
true